diff --git a/api/open-api/libs/open-sdk-1.0.2.jar b/api/open-api/libs/open-sdk-1.0.2.jar
deleted file mode 100644
index e4e24be4..00000000
Binary files a/api/open-api/libs/open-sdk-1.0.2.jar and /dev/null differ
diff --git a/api/open-api/libs/open-sdk-1.4.20.jar b/api/open-api/libs/open-sdk-1.4.20.jar
new file mode 100644
index 00000000..83a202a4
Binary files /dev/null and b/api/open-api/libs/open-sdk-1.4.20.jar differ
diff --git a/api/open-api/pom.xml b/api/open-api/pom.xml
index 4241853f..2bd3e52f 100644
--- a/api/open-api/pom.xml
+++ b/api/open-api/pom.xml
@@ -75,42 +75,6 @@
mybatis-plus-spring-boot3-starter
3.5.5
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
net.logstash.logback
logstash-logback-encoder
@@ -120,33 +84,12 @@
org.springframework.boot
spring-boot-starter-webflux
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
cn.qihangerp.open
open-sdk
1.0.2
system
- ${project.basedir}/libs/open-sdk-1.0.2.jar
+ ${project.basedir}/libs/open-sdk-1.4.20.jar
org.projectlombok
diff --git a/api/open-api/src/main/java/cn/qihangerp/open/tao/controller/TaoGoodsApiController.java b/api/open-api/src/main/java/cn/qihangerp/open/tao/controller/TaoGoodsApiController.java
index de8a4853..bec91e6b 100644
--- a/api/open-api/src/main/java/cn/qihangerp/open/tao/controller/TaoGoodsApiController.java
+++ b/api/open-api/src/main/java/cn/qihangerp/open/tao/controller/TaoGoodsApiController.java
@@ -6,6 +6,7 @@ import cn.qihangerp.common.ResultVoEnum;
import cn.qihangerp.common.api.ShopApiParams;
import cn.qihangerp.common.enums.EnumShopType;
import cn.qihangerp.common.enums.HttpStatus;
+import cn.qihangerp.common.utils.DateUtils;
import cn.qihangerp.common.utils.StringUtils;
import cn.qihangerp.domain.OShopPullLasttime;
import cn.qihangerp.domain.OShopPullLogs;
@@ -15,7 +16,6 @@ import cn.qihangerp.module.open.tao.service.TaoGoodsService;
import cn.qihangerp.module.service.OShopPullLasttimeService;
import cn.qihangerp.module.service.OShopPullLogsService;
import cn.qihangerp.open.common.ApiResultVo;
-import cn.qihangerp.open.common.DateUtil;
import cn.qihangerp.open.tao.TaoApiCommon;
import cn.qihangerp.open.tao.TaoGoodsApiHelper;
import cn.qihangerp.open.tao.TaoRequest;
@@ -113,11 +113,11 @@ public class TaoGoodsApiController {
taoGoods.setHasInvoice(g.isHas_invoice() + "");
taoGoods.setHasWarranty(g.isHas_warranty() + "");
taoGoods.setHasShowcase(g.isHas_showcase() + "");
- taoGoods.setModified(DateUtil.stringtoDate(g.getModified()));
- taoGoods.setDelistTime(StringUtils.isEmpty(g.getDelist_time()) ? null : DateUtil.stringtoDate(g.getDelist_time()));
+ taoGoods.setModified(DateUtils.stringtoDate(g.getModified()));
+ taoGoods.setDelistTime(StringUtils.isEmpty(g.getDelist_time()) ? null : DateUtils.stringtoDate(g.getDelist_time()));
taoGoods.setPostageId(g.getPostage_id());
taoGoods.setOuterId(g.getOuter_id());
- taoGoods.setListTime(StringUtils.isEmpty(g.getList_time()) ? null : DateUtil.stringtoDate(g.getList_time()));
+ taoGoods.setListTime(StringUtils.isEmpty(g.getList_time()) ? null : DateUtils.stringtoDate(g.getList_time()));
taoGoods.setPrice(g.getPrice());
taoGoods.setSoldQuantity(g.getSold_quantity());
taoGoods.setShopId(req.getShopId());
diff --git a/api/open-api/src/main/java/cn/qihangerp/open/wei/WeiApiCommon.java b/api/open-api/src/main/java/cn/qihangerp/open/wei/WeiApiCommon.java
index 3601c69f..3b1769d7 100644
--- a/api/open-api/src/main/java/cn/qihangerp/open/wei/WeiApiCommon.java
+++ b/api/open-api/src/main/java/cn/qihangerp/open/wei/WeiApiCommon.java
@@ -8,7 +8,7 @@ import cn.qihangerp.common.enums.HttpStatus;
import cn.qihangerp.domain.OShop;
import cn.qihangerp.module.service.OShopService;
import cn.qihangerp.open.common.ApiResultVo;
-import cn.qihangerp.open.wei.response.WeiTokenResponse;
+import cn.qihangerp.open.wei.WeiTokenResponse;
import lombok.AllArgsConstructor;
import org.springframework.stereotype.Component;
import org.springframework.util.StringUtils;
diff --git a/api/open-api/src/main/java/cn/qihangerp/open/wei/controller/WeiOrderApiController.java b/api/open-api/src/main/java/cn/qihangerp/open/wei/controller/WeiOrderApiController.java
index b21c4da4..50cdc29c 100644
--- a/api/open-api/src/main/java/cn/qihangerp/open/wei/controller/WeiOrderApiController.java
+++ b/api/open-api/src/main/java/cn/qihangerp/open/wei/controller/WeiOrderApiController.java
@@ -54,7 +54,7 @@ public class WeiOrderApiController extends BaseController {
// String appSecret = checkResult.getData().getAppSecret();
LocalDateTime endTime = LocalDateTime.now();
LocalDateTime startTime = endTime.minusHours(1);
- ApiResultVo orderApiResultVo = WeiOrderApiHelper.pullOrderList(startTime, endTime, accessToken, null, null);
+ ApiResultVo orderApiResultVo = WeiOrderApiHelper.pullOrderList(startTime, endTime, accessToken);
// ApiResultVo apiResultVo = OrderApiHelper.pullOrderList(startTime, endTime, accessToken);
int insertSuccess = 0;//新增成功的订单
diff --git a/core/common/src/main/java/cn/qihangerp/common/utils/DateUtils.java b/core/common/src/main/java/cn/qihangerp/common/utils/DateUtils.java
index 34952250..289d0a2a 100644
--- a/core/common/src/main/java/cn/qihangerp/common/utils/DateUtils.java
+++ b/core/common/src/main/java/cn/qihangerp/common/utils/DateUtils.java
@@ -93,7 +93,34 @@ public class DateUtils extends org.apache.commons.lang3.time.DateUtils
throw new RuntimeException(e);
}
}
+ /**
+ * 把符合日期格式的字符串转换为日期类型
+ */
+ public static Date stringtoDate(String dateStr, String format) {
+ Date d = null;
+ SimpleDateFormat formater = new SimpleDateFormat(format);
+ try {
+ formater.setLenient(false);
+ d = formater.parse(dateStr);
+ } catch (Exception e) {
+ // log.error(e);
+ d = null;
+ }
+ return d;
+ }
+ public static Date stringtoDate(String dateStr) {
+ Date d = null;
+ SimpleDateFormat formater = new SimpleDateFormat("yyyy-MM-dd HH:mm:ss");
+ try {
+ formater.setLenient(false);
+ d = formater.parse(dateStr);
+ } catch (Exception e) {
+ // log.error(e);
+ d = null;
+ }
+ return d;
+ }
/**
* 时间字符串转时间戳
* @param format